Developed by Carlsmed, a leader in data-to-device technology for spine surgery, aprevo® provides data-driven insights to help surgeons optimize surgical plans, simulate procedures and achieve predictable outcomes for patients. It uses advanced algorithms and state-of-the-art 3D modeling to develop individualized surgical plans and shows interbody fusion implants to match. Each implant is designed to support the spine in the planned alignment and provide improved load distribution to protect the spine during healing.
